PLASTIC INSULATED CONTROL POWER CABLE
Plastic insulated control cable is a multi-core cable that uses thermoplastic materials such as polyvinyl chloride (PVC) or polyethylene (PE) as the insulation layer. It is mainly used for control signal transmission and instrument connection between electrical equipment. This type of cable is usually composed of copper conductor, plastic insulation layer, filling material, and sheath. It has the characteristics of good flexibility and convenient laying. It is suitable for control systems with a rated voltage of 450/750V and below.
The core characteristics of plastic insulated control cable are good electrical insulation performance and mechanical protection ability. Its insulation material can effectively prevent signal crosstalk between lines, and has certain oil resistance, acid, and alkali corrosion resistance. The cable structure design takes into account the flexibility and tensile strength requirements, which is convenient for complex wiring between equipment; some models also use a shielding layer design, which can effectively suppress electromagnetic interference and ensure accurate transmission of control signals.
In terms of industrial applications, plastic insulated control cables are widely used in scenes such as factory automation production lines, building control systems, and electrical connections of mechanical equipment. In petrochemical enterprises, oil-resistant control cables are used to connect various instruments and control systems; in the field of rail transit, flame-retardant cables ensure the reliable operation of signal systems; centralized control of lighting, air conditioning, and other equipment in intelligent buildings also relies on this type of cable to achieve signal transmission.
